
This modern mountain farmhouse, reimagined by Purple Cherry Architects, offers sweeping views of the Blue Ridge Mountains in Etlan, Virginia. This home is the result of an extensive renovation that combined an old post-and-beam barn with a new addition. The homeowner, who regularly hiked beloved Old Rag Mountain as a child, envisioned a spacious weekend mountain retreat where extended family could also gather for holidays.
The residence thoughtfully incorporates reclaimed timbers from the original barn and stone found on the farm with modern materials such as board and batten siding, standing seam metal roofing, and cable railing. Expansive windows and a glass link connecting the new addition take advantage of idyllic mountain views, while also offering direct access to a covered Ipe deck and bluestone paved pool.
